When I was a senior in high school, one of my good buddies smoked too much weed while being on anti-depressants and Accutane and decided to run away from home for a few days. He eventually (temporarily) regained his sanity and came home to his parents. Well, that only lasted a few days before he finally just didn't show up for school one day and left all of us (his close friends) small, perpetual motion knick-knack toys in our mail box.

We later found out he moved to Colorado (I'm not originally from here) to join some cult called something like The Brothers of Atlantis (I forget the exact name). I spoke to him briefly since (this was a few years ago), and he told me how they grow soy beans and whatnot but wouldn't tell me much else because the leader was "being chased by the government."

I think I saw some homeless guy who looked just like him in Boulder, but I was never sure if it was actually him or not.

Yoga, meditating, lectures, vegetarian living.  I think she was on the residential staff, and the place was like a spiritual resort/retreat for people who paid to stay there for a week or two. I think she was a cook or something. You volunteer to work and live there but you don't get paid.  In return you get to live around other spiritually-oriented people and not have to worry about having a real job, family, bills, etc.

Never really talked to her about it because I was never interested about it.  She's a nurse now and married, in her 40's.
